Workplace Programs to Improve Air Quality

At Austin Energy we have a goal to lead the industry in environmental stewardship and conservation programs. Our employees take that commitment to the environment very seriously. They develop award-winning conservation programs for our commercial and residential customers. And, they also find ways that they, as employees, can contribute.

Reducing Vehicle Use Improves Air Quality
More vehicles on the road equal more vehicle emissions. To reduce emissions, our employees are reducing their vehicle miles traveled (VMT) to work. Lowering VMTs reduces vehicle emissions and improves air quality. Annually, employee participation in workplace air quality programs saves 167,000 trips equaling 2 million VMTs.

Variety of Commuting Options Makes Program a Success

Compressed Work Week
Employees work longer hours, but fewer days per week.
Telecommuting
Employees work one or more days from their homes, via computer and phone.
Flex Time
Employees adjust their work schedules to miss rush hour traffic
Alternate Transportation
Employees use alternate transportation means to reduce the number of vehicles in the central business district.
Biking or walking
Carpooling with other Austin Energy or City of Austin employees
Riding the bus – Austin Energy covers the cost of bus passes
Using Capital Metro van pool or special transit services
